906The Death of Metaphysical Analyticity and the Failure of Boghossian's Analytic Theory of the A PrioriRes Cogitans 6 (1): 61-68. 2009.Many philosophers still believe that metaphysically analytic sentences exist, where a sentence is understood to be metaphysically analytic if and only if it is true solely in virtue of its meaning. I provide two arguments against this claim and hence conclude that metaphysically analytic sentences do not exist.
